华硕笔记本更换内存通病
前言看到一个博主传授的华硕笔记本的通病,一个小众知识,故此来记录下,以免以后遇到可以使用
故障现象据操作人所说:华硕笔记本拆卸后,装回去之后就无法开机,上电之后就断电了。
就现象而言,这种大概率就是内存问题,或者cpu问题,这次的只是这个牌子的通病
解决办法华硕笔记本的bios,有一个通病:更换大内存之后,必须要先通过原来8G或者16G的内存重置bios才能使用
正所谓,客户的话只能信一半,不好说是不是真的只是拆机没动,这点博主也没说这个问题是否有可能拆机导致,但是现象就大概率能定位两点,cpu或者内存。
所以最后的解决办法就是:
更换回一个8G或者16G的内存条进入bios;
重置bios设置;
换回大内存重启。
内存紧张导致磁盘占用排查笔记
内存紧张导致磁盘空间“消失”排查笔记
物理内存 8 GB,空闲仅 1.3 GB,发现 C 盘随开机时间持续减少,重启后恢复。怀疑 pagefile.sys 自动膨胀引起,遂记录排查与恢复步骤。
检查 pagefile 当前配置1wmic pagefile list /format:list
关键字段含义
AllocatedBaseSize 系统已分配大小(MB)
CurrentUsage 实时占用(MB)
PeakUsage 历史峰值(MB)
AutomaticManagedPagefile 是否自动管理(TRUE/FALSE)
检查实时交换率1typeperf "\Paging File(_Total)\% Usage" -sc 1
返回示例1"10/09/2025 17:39:58.297","14.693229"
14.7 % 确认当前仅用到 1 GB 左右,但系统已预分配 7 GB。
关闭自动管理并锁定上限(应急止血)12345678:: 关闭自动管理wmic computers ...
windhawk-windows美化
来自
点击跳转b站”麦嘎噔Linux“的视频
效果:
需要下载的软件和插件
先软件下载:windhawk官网:https://windhawk.net/
然后在windhawk中下载插件Taskbar height and icon size、Windows 11 Start Menu Styler、Windows 11 Taskbar Styler
插件配置Taskbar height and icon size仅参考,可以自定义合适的大小1234567891011121314Taskbar height:55Icon size:26Taskbar button width:40Small icon size:20Small taskbar button width:32
Windows 11 Start Menu Styler修改高级设置中的Mod设置
Mod设置:1{"controlStyles[0].target":"StartDocked.StartSizingFrame","controlSt ...
mysql数据库的使用
sql权限MySQL / MariaDB
创建账号1CREATE USER 'username'@'host' IDENTIFIED BY 'password';
授权12GRANT ALL PRIVILEGES ON mydb.* TO 'alice'@'localhost';FLUSH PRIVILEGES;
mydb.*为数据库名称,授权整个数据库
PostgreSQL
创建账号1CREATE USER username WITH PASSWORD 'password';
授权1GRANT ALL PRIVILEGES ON DATABASE mydb TO alice;
SQL Server
创建账号12CREATE LOGIN username WITH PASSWORD = 'password';CREATE USER username FOR LOGIN username;
Oracle
创建账号1CREATE USER u ...
termux安装mariadb
前言在 Termux 里其实装不了“官方”MySQL,但官方仓库里直接提供了 MariaDB(MySQL 的完全兼容分支),对移动端更轻量,也足够学习/调试使用。这种部署方式不会影响学习:
SQL 语法 100% 通用MariaDB 完全兼容 MySQL 5.7/8.x 的主流语法(SELECT、JOIN、窗口函数、事务、索引、MVCC)。
引擎层体验无差异默认都是 InnoDB,ACID、锁等待、行版本、redo/undo log 机制一样;EXPLAIN 计划格式略有输出顺序差异,不影响调优思路。
不足的部分
MySQL 8 的 CTE/窗口函数 MariaDB 10.6+ 也有;
没有 JSON 数据类型(MariaDB 用 LONGTEXT + 检查约束模拟),但语法 JSON_EXTRACT 兼容;
没有 roles、resource group、clone plugin 等 DBA 高级特性——这些对“开发+调优”阶段学习占比 <5%。
等以后到公司用云数据库,再花 1-2 小时就能补齐。
安装步骤环境准备12345# 更新源pkg update & ...
linux多网卡修改网关
前言linux修改默认路由表,一般情况下使用route增删查即可,但多网卡情况下,linux出网使用默认路由表,但被访问时,回包走的却不是,如果只添加route add/del回包下一跳很有可能还是添加之前的路由,原因很大可能是因为需要创建被访问网卡的路由表;如果遇到这样的情况,可以按照如下方式修改尝试。
以下情况设置为两个网卡的情况
不同段情况下修改默认路由表
新增新网关,删除旧网关12route add -net 0.0.0.0/0 gw 网关 dev 网卡名称route del -net 0.0.0.0/0 gw 旧网关
永久生效,写入开机自启文件12echo "route add -net 0.0.0.0/0 gw 网关 dev 网卡名称" >> rc.localecho "route del -net 0.0.0.0/0 gw 旧网关" >> rc.local
创建路由表创建两个路由表分别为:route-table1,route-table212echo "10 route-table1&quo ...
自启动和计划任务查询
速查表(一句话版)
系统
自启
计划任务
Ubuntu
systemctl list-unit-files --state=enabled
crontab -l && systemctl list-timers
CentOS/RHEL
systemctl list-unit-files --state=enabled
crontab -l && systemctl list-timers
Windows
reg query "HKLM\...\Run"
schtasks /query
macOS
ls ~/Library/LaunchAgents/
launchctl list && crontab -l
FreeBSD
service -e
crontab -l && ls /etc/periodic/
Ubuntu / Debian / Linux Mint12345678910111213141516171819202122232425# 系统级 syste ...
挖矿排查方法
辅助工具
工具名称
用途
安装方式
rkhunter
检测rootkit、挖矿木马
apt install rkhunter
chkrootkit
检测隐藏进程与后门
apt install chkrootkit
clamav
全盘病毒扫描
apt install clamav
通用确认进程
输出高CPU进程检查是否有名为 java、python、bash、sshd、kworker 等伪装进程 1ps -eo pid,ppid,cmd,%cpu --sort=-%cpu | head -n 20
检查进程实际路径如果路径指向 /tmp/.X11-unix/…、.font-unix/、.configrc5/ 等,极可能是挖矿木马 1ls -l /proc/$PID/exe
检查网络连接是否连向矿池检查是否有陌生的外联地址1sudo netstat -antlp | grep ESTABLISHED
可使用 情报社区 或 VirusTotal 查询IP是否为矿池
排查计划任务与启动项
系统
自启
计划任务
Ubuntu
systemctl l ...
playwright-基础使用
官网
官方:https://playwright.dev/docs/intro中文网:https://playwright.nodejs.cn/
高频常用语法123456789101112131415161718// 启动并打开页面with sync_playwright() as p: browser = p.chromium.launch(headless=False) # 改成 True 可后台 context = browser.new_context() page = context.new_page()// 输入 & 点击page.locator('#user').fill('admin');page.getByRole('button', { name: '登录' }).click();// 断言expect(page.locator('.welcome')).toHaveText('欢迎 admin');// 截图 ...
apt源
修改 APT 源手动修改 sources.list
备份原文件:
1s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ak
编辑源文件:
1sudo nano /etc/apt/sources.list
替换为官方源(以 Ubuntu 22.04 为例):
1234deb http://archive.ubuntu.com/ubuntu jammy main restricted universe multiversedeb http://archive.ubuntu.com/ubuntu jammy-updates main restricted universe multiversedeb http://archive.ubuntu.com/ubuntu jammy-security main restricted universe multiversedeb http://archive.ubuntu.com/ubuntu jammy-backports main restricted universe multiver ...
数据库加载中
